溫馨提示×

Ubuntu dhclient在虛擬機中的應用

小樊
55
2025-08-03 16:29:59
欄目: 云計算

在Ubuntu虛擬機中使用dhclient命令可以配置網絡接口以自動獲取IP地址、子網掩碼、默認網關和DNS服務器等信息。以下是詳細步驟:

在Ubuntu虛擬機中配置DHCP客戶端

  1. 查看當前網絡狀態

    • 使用 ip a命令查看IP地址。
    • 使用 ip r命令查看路由表。
    • 使用 cat /etc/resolv.conf命令查看DNS配置。
  2. 配置DHCP客戶端

    • 使用netplan(適用于Ubuntu 18.04+)

      編輯 /etc/netplan/01-netcfg.yaml文件,添加或修改以下內容:

      network:
        version: 2
        ethernets:
          eth0:
            dhcp4: true
      

      然后應用配置:

      sudo netplan apply
      
    • 使用傳統interfaces(適用于老系統或手動設置)

      編輯 /etc/network/interfaces文件,添加或修改以下內容:

      auto eth0
      iface eth0 inet dhcp
      

      重啟網絡服務:

      sudo systemctl restart networking
      
  3. 動態獲取IP地址

    使用以下命令臨時獲取DHCP IP地址:

    sudo dhclient eth0
    
  4. 確認生效

    運行以下命令確認已獲取IP地址:

    • 使用 ip addr show eth0查看IP地址。
    • 使用 ip route show查看網關。
    • 使用 cat /etc/resolv.conf查看DNS配置。

注意事項

  • 虛擬機用戶應注意橋接或啟用DHCP服務。
  • DHCP失效可能是由于沒有DHCP服務器響應、網線或虛擬網絡未連接等原因。

通過以上步驟,您可以在Ubuntu虛擬機中成功配置dhclient以自動獲取網絡配置信息,從而簡化網絡管理過程。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女